The Department of
Mathematics and Statistics and the Department of
Biostatistics and Epidemiology of the
University of Massachusetts-Amherst are
excited to co-host the 32nd annual New
England Statistics Symposium (NESS) on Saturday,
April 13-14, 2018: https://symposium.nestat.org/index.html
The theme of NESS 2018 is “Data - Science - Society”,
reflecting the growing role that data
and statistical sciences are playing in shaping
and improving society.
We invite submissions from student
authors for the IBM Student Paper Competition and
the MassMutual Student Poster Competition. Abstract submissions
for the student paper and poster competitions are due March
26, 2018. The cost of the conference is free to students
who present and only $20 for students who do not present:
https://symposium.nestat.org/call-for-participation.html
Additionally, a set of short courses will
be offered on Friday, April 13th, on a range of topics including
Bayesian modeling using Stan (taught by Stan core developers),
causal inference, patient-reported outcomes, and more. For more
information, please check
https://symposium.nestat.org/short-courses.html
